소스 검색

Makefile: updated to reflect new folder structure

Daniel-Constantin Mierla 3 년 전
부모
커밋
f39273c915
1개의 변경된 파일10개의 추가작업 그리고 9개의 파일을 삭제
  1. 10 9
      Makefile

+ 10 - 9
Makefile

@@ -1,16 +1,17 @@
-TXTDIR=html
-MDS=$(shell find * -name '*.md')
-HTMLS=$(patsubst %.md,$(TXTDIR)/%.html, $(MDS))
+OUTDIR?=html
+MDS=$(shell find docs/* -name '*.md')
+HTMLS=$(patsubst %.md,$(OUTDIR)/%.html, $(MDS))
 
 .PHONY : all
 
-all : $(HTMLS) $(TXTDIR)
+all : $(HTMLS) $(OUTDIR)
+
 clean :
-	rm -rf $(TXTDIR)
+	rm -rf $(OUTDIR)
 
-$(TXTDIR) :
-	mkdir -p $(TXTDIR)
+$(OUTDIR) :
+	mkdir -p $(OUTDIR)
 
-$(TXTDIR)/%.html : %.md $(TXTDIR)
+$(OUTDIR)/%.html : %.md $(OUTDIR)
 	mkdir -p $$(dirname $@)
-	pandoc --toc --lua-filter=links.lua -t html -f markdown -s $< -o $@
+	pandoc --toc --lua-filter=fmt/pandoc/links.lua -t html -f markdown -s $< -o $@